VERB
激勵(lì);鼓舞;驅(qū)使
If someone or something inspires you to do something new or unusual, they make you want to do it.
例句
These herbs will inspire you to try out all sorts of exotic-flavoured dishes!...
這些香草會(huì)激發(fā)你去品嘗各種異國(guó)風(fēng)味的菜肴!
Our challenge is to motivate those voters and inspire them to join our cause...
我們面臨的挑戰(zhàn)是如何調(diào)動(dòng)那些選民的積極性并鼓勵(lì)他們加入我們的事業(yè)。
-
VERB
啟發(fā);使產(chǎn)生靈感和熱情
If someone or something inspires you, they give you new ideas and a strong feeling of enthusiasm.
例句
Jimi Hendrix inspired a generation of guitarists.
吉米·亨德里克斯啟發(fā)了整整一代吉他演奏者。
-
VERB
作為…的為靈感來源;是…的原型
If a book, work of art, or action is inspired by something, that thing is the source of the idea for it.
例句
The book was inspired by a real person, namely Tamara de Treaux.
那本書的靈感源于一個(gè)真實(shí)人物,即塔瑪拉·德特羅。
...a political murder inspired by the same nationalist conflicts now wrecking the country.
正是由正在毀掉該國(guó)的民族主義沖突激發(fā)的一起政治謀殺
-
VERB
激起,喚起(某種感情或反應(yīng))
Someone or something that inspires a particular emotion or reaction in people makes them feel this emotion or reaction.
例句
The car's performance quickly inspires confidence.
該汽車的性能會(huì)很快喚起駕駛者的信心。
